People circle around their own egos with a constant longing for balance. But the point where everything is in equilibrium is unreachable. Egopoint is the most recent choreography by Nadja Saidakova, principle dancer with the Staatsballett Berlin, and will have its Moscow premiere as a co-production with Theatre Ballet Moscow. Nadja Saidakova's choreographic work is inspired by her personal experiences: "How to find harmony between the incredible dynamism of our crazy lives and the deep human desire to discover oneself?" Her abstractly designed choreography circles around a little cosmos of human relations. Almost unnecessary to mention, Nadja Saidakova will draw on her extensive vocabulary of classical movements. She describes her choreographic momentum: "There are more ideas in a dancer's body than one can actually retrieve; and the more experience you gather the bigger the urge for freedom." The Egopoint ballet music is a composition by The 7th Plain (Luke Slater's Ambient and Experimental Project) and a journey put together using new and re-worked tracks. ZIL Cultural Center |
